More on Nintendo’s Profits

Earlier on I posted about Nintendo’s rather good financial performance. Seems now that they aren’t performing so well this year. Still, it’s worth keeping in mind that their competitors all made losses within the same year. Apparently they have only released 10 first party games this year, which would go some way to explaining the smaller profits.

I’m guessing they they are slowing down production in general and pooling resources for the launch of the Revolution. Seen in that light, lower profits could be interpreted as an investment.
